Minnesota Soybean Research and Promotion Council Uzbekistan Trade Mission Update 

The Minnesota Soybean Research and Promotion Council (MSRPC) is about half way through the Trade Mission in Uzbekistan, and met with US Ambassador to Uzbekistan Jonathan Henick. Pine to Prairie Pheasants Forever hosting Annual Banquet 

The Pine to Prairie Pheasants Forever chapter will be hosting their Annual Banquet Fundraiser on March 22 at the Holiday Inn in Detroit Lakes. MN Senate hears testimony about bill that would transfer ownership of White Earth State Forest

The Minnesota Senate Committee on Environment, Climate and Legacy heard testimony from area entities about Senate bill SF 3480 which would transfer ownership of White Earth State Forest from the State Government to White Earth Nation.
